NGC Software today announced that Brian Brothers, developers of the
popular urban menswear brand Jordan Craig, is implementing NGC’s fashion
PLM and Supply Chain Management (SCM) system. The rapidly growing
apparel brand reviewed apparel software solutions from other leading PLM
vendors and chose NGC based on its extensive knowledge of the fashion
industry and the strength and flexibility of its best-in-class
enterprise solution.
NGC’s PLM/SCM system will provide Brian Brothers with an enterprise
platform that easily shares information among its design and production
teams, improving collaboration, accuracy and responsiveness.
“We need a platform that gives us one version of the truth,” said Brian
Chang, production and design manager, Brian Brothers. “Without a
centralized system, it’s impossible to know if everyone is working with
the same information; otherwise, you may have situations where one team
is working from a different set of specs than another. We need to not
only improve speed to market, but also minimize mistakes and have better
communications with our overseas producers.”
“We want to be able to spend more time on our design, which is our core
strength,” he continued. “NGC’s software will enable us to do that.”
The flexibility of NGC’s enterprise platform was an important factor in
Brian Brother’s selection of NGC. The PLM/SCM system will integrate
seamlessly with Brian Brothers’ legacy ERP solution, which will allow
Brian Brothers to implement a fashion design and production system
without having to undergo a costly ERP replacement.
NGC’s industry knowledge was a big plus, too. “NGC’s people are very
knowledgeable, with lots of industry experience in apparel,” Chang said.
“They were very responsive and accommodating, and that gave us
confidence in moving forward with NGC.”

About Brian Brothers
Brian Brothers launched the Jordan Craig brand in 1989 with the goal of
delivering the finest quality garments to its customers. With its roots
in retail, the company saw a void in the market and set out to create
high-quality garments that the working man could afford. The company has
evolved and changed many times over the years, but still holds true to
